I am disappointed how the Printing on the Word 2010 Document works. The old Word 2000, I thought was more efficient because it was more Keyboard friendly, Ctrl + P, 22(number of copies[1 is default]), Alt + E(for current page) goes it print. Whereas Word 2010 you cane Ctrl + P, Use the mouse to change number of copies, Drag the mouse to change current page. Unbelievable, it's time consuming.
Printing the Fax is worst. There is no number of copies, no current page either, therefore it will print the whole pages. If the page is black, it will waste my ink in no time. Please help!!!!

Dear Dante,
I'm sorry it's taken me so long to respond. I was hoping to find a better answer.
As far as keyboard shortcuts for printing, you can use CTRL+P and then press TAB to get to the number of copies. From there, you need to use keytips (ALT+P to see the keytips, ALT+A and then the DOWN ARROW key to get to Current Page, then ALT+P,P to print). It isn't as direct as ALT+E, but you can avoid using the mouse.
As for Printing with Fax, I'm seeing Current Page and Custom Range, but that might depend on how Word interacts with the fax software.
